| - I went to Donovan's for the first time last week with my husband using a Living Social voucher. I was very excited to have amazing prime beef steak. I was a little disappointed. We ordered shrimp cocktail which was perfect. They were huge and yummy. My roasted beet salad was very good, but drowning in dressing which I asked for on the side, but the kitchen messed up on that. My husband's wedge salad was very good, but also overloaded on dressing. I ordered my filet med rare, yet only the center core was cooked properly, the outside was medium. I was a little disappointed with that. The broccoli and baby carrots were only slightly cooked, so very very crunchy still. Husband's rib eye was cooked perfectly. Although I have to say, the steaks are blandly seasoned. The cappuccino was perfect.
I want to say that I did bring up the salad mess up to the waiter, and he offered to bring me a new salad right away, but I declined as I don't like to waste food. As for the steak, I didn't complain because I just couldn't bring myself to waste a whole steak like that.
I wouldn't normally return after this experience, but this restaurant has a wonderful waiter named Shane, who really tried to make up for my experience. He loves his job, and was so kind and enthusiastic about Donovan's restaurant that I think I would give this place another try. Donovan's is fortunate to employ a server like Shane. His attitude and service will bring customers back.
Next time I will try the Chilean sea bass or the Halibut! ;)
